On Sun, Feb 08, 2015 at 10:38:23PM -0800, Kenneth Westfield wrote:
So I add a machine driver that selects the clocking freq in hw_params
and calls set_sysclk in the DAIs.
The DT node for the machine driver would look something like:
        default_system_clock_frequency = < xxxxxx >;
        alternate_system_clock_frequency = < xxxxxx >;
        cpu_dai = < &cpu >;
        codec_dai = < &codec >;
        pinctrl... ?
Why are the system clock frequencies being specified in the DT at all -
can't we either figure out the constraints from something else or just
set the rates to something sensible that the driver knows (allowing for
improvements in the driver in the future).
Does this sound ok?  Also, would it make sense to move the pinctrl back
to the machine driver?
Why would we want to do that?
